Smooth muscle myosin isoform expression and LC20 phosphorylation in innate rat airway hyperresponsiveness.

Four smooth muscle myosin heavy chain (SMMHC) isoforms are generated by alternative mRNA splicing of a single gene. Two of these isoforms differ by the presence [(+)insert] or absence [(-)insert] of a 7-amino acid insert in the motor domain.
